Wild Rush - Strawberry Clover, by Darn That Alarm

Winner of the $600,000 G2 Louisiana Derby and $443,818

After breaking his maiden by eight lengths at Santa Anita, WIMBLEDON was the decisive
winner of the $600,000 Louisiana Derby (G2), defeating multiple G1 winner BORREGO and
millionaire POLLARD'S VISION, to become a top contender for the Kentucky Derby, before
a minor injury forced him to be scratched. WIMBLEDON retired with earnings of $443,818.

By multiple G1 winner WILD RUSH, the sire of Champion JUDITHS WILD RUSH,
millionaire multiple G1 winners STELLAR JAYNE and HOLLYWOOD STORY,
and 2007 standout DREAM RUSH, winner of the G1 Prioress and Darley Test Stakes.

WIMBLEDON is a half-brother to the dam of G1-placed Master Australis.

WIMBLEDON'S first foals are yearlings of 2008.
